財務健全性

The company reported total revenue of $805.72M for the trailing twelve months, yet it recorded a net income loss of $125,459,000, revealing a cost structure where operating expenses and interest costs significantly outpace the gross profits generated from sales. Despite the net loss, the company generated positive EBITDA of $80.58M, indicating that core business operations remain cash-flow positive before financing costs and taxes, though this figure is heavily offset by significant interest obligations. Free cash flow for the period was negative at $18,293,750, which limits the company's financial flexibility and its ability to fund capital expenditures or strategic acquisitions without external financing. The gross margin stands at 17.3%, while the operating margin is 7.2%, and the profit margin is negative at -11.4%, illustrating that after accounting for all operational and financing expenses, the company is unable to retain earnings from its sales revenue. On the balance sheet, the company holds $4.17M in cash against a total debt load of $651.75M, resulting in a debt-to-equity ratio of 584.66, which characterizes the capital structure as extremely leveraged and reliant on continuous refinancing or new borrowing. The current ratio is 0.43, a metric that indicates the company possesses less than half the current assets necessary to cover its current liabilities, signaling potential short-term liquidity constraints. Return on Equity is -59.8% and Return on Assets is 2.5%, metrics that reveal management is currently destroying shareholder value through the high cost of debt and operational inefficiencies, despite maintaining a nominal positive return on the total asset base.

The ONE Group Hospitality, Inc.について

The ONE Group Hospitality, Inc., a restaurant company, owns, develops, operates, manages, licenses, and franchises restaurants worldwide. The company operates through STK, Benihana, and Grill Concepts segments. Its restaurant brands include STK, an American steakhouse that serves steaks, seafood, and specialty cocktails; Benihana, a dining destination wherein chefs prepare food in front of guests and serve sushi and cocktails; Kona Grill, a casual bar-centric grill concept that serves American sushi and specialty cocktails; and RA Sushi, a Japanese cuisine concept that offered sushi and drinks. The company also provides One Hospitality, a platform composed of F&B hospitality management services, which includes development, management, and operation of restaurants, bars, rooftop lounges, banqueting and catering facilities, private dining rooms, room service, and mini bars of hotels and casinos; and hospitality advisory and consulting services. In addition, it operates Heliot, a steakhouse and bar; Radio Rooftop, a rooftop restaurant and lounge bar concept; Rivershore Bar & Grill; and Salt Water Social, which offers seafood items, beef dishes, and cocktails. The company was founded in 2004 and is based in Denver, Colorado.
